When I got my new PC a couple of years ago I took the advice of a friend and used partitions. I have XP Pro installed on one partition, I installed all of my favourite applications to a seperate partition, and all of my media files are on a different hard drive.

Hard Drive 1:

C: Windows and a few bits and bobs

F: Applications and Games

Hard Drive 2:

E: Media Files, ISOs, Downloads, etc

Recently I've been looking into a slimmer version of XP, customised with nLite to cut down on hard drive bloat and memory hogging. I hear I can reduce installations towards 100mb and use closer to 40mb of RAM than the usual 300mb! My situation is this: I want to reinstall Windows XP, erasing my current C: partition containing my installation. However, when I'm done I'll still have all my programs and games waiting for me on my other partition.

Is there an easy way to get Windows to find and recognise these games and apps without reinstalling them?

Is there an easy way to get Windows to find and recognise these games and apps without reinstalling them?

No easy way for Windows to do it automated that I know of, but in that situation all I do is edit the Start menu and just add shortcuts to whatever games I want.
